Hybrid is superior quality copolymer nylon monofilament, coated with a micro thin layer of fluorocarbon. The 2 bonds of materials combine the high performing characteristics of both materials.

Strength / Diameter Copolymer is easy to knot but loses up to 20% of it's strength when wet. The fluorocarbon coating maintains the wet strength of the tippet which means you can fish a tippet up to 20% thinner than you could if you used pure nylon. Fishing a thinner tippet means that you can fish smaller flies, more naturally and spook less fish. 

Light reflection Light reflecting off the clear surface of tippet spooks fish. Hybrid has a very slight grey tint which reduces light glare by 60% which results in more fish hooked. 

Abrasion resistance Fluorocarbon is more abrasion resistance than nylon but is also a little stiffer. Combining nylon and fluorocarbon creates a supple but robust tippet material that will not break when fishing over snags. Essential when nymphing is boulder strewn rivers.

Knots Pure fluorocarbon is very hard to knot. Heat builds up and snaps the tippet. Nylon is very easy to tie. Combining the 2 materials means you can benefit from all the features of fluorocarbon but still tie knots very easily with cold / wet hands.

Stretch Fluorocarbon stretches less than copolymer. Hybrid stretches less than pure copolymer because it is coated with fluorocarbon.
